You Asked: What are the Benefits for Adults with ADD and ADHD taking omega 3?

The omega-3 fatty acids help support a normal brain function. Adults take Res-Q 1250. A lot of studies in American Journal of Clinical Nutrition have been conducted on children. However, adults may obtain the same results. Some of our customers tell us that their children pay attention better, sit and focus longer than they used to.


Low levels of omega-3 fatty acids have been found in these children. Since omega-3 has to be converted into EPA and DHA, supplementation with a potent grade of EPA/DHA is necessary, because the body gets a direct supply of EPA and DHA. Therefore, supplementation may help correct the deficiency.


If a poor dietary intake or a poor ability to metabolize omega-3 into active omega-3 fatty acids EPA and DHA is happening, then supplementing the diet with a direct source of EPA and DHA, such as Res-Q 1250, would be beneficial to restore levels.


Omega-3 fatty acids are important to the brain development, health, structure, and function of the brain which is comprised of fats. It has been suggested that the type of fat consumed can affect the function of the brain. Only from specific fatty fish can we obtain a sufficient amount of the good omega-3 fats from diet. Due to the fact that children don't like fish, fish is not consumed often enough, and safety issues surround fish consumption, if you are looking for a very good supplement to give your child, a pure, safe omega-3 fatty acid supplement would be very beneficial to supplement the diet to help ensure that omega-3 is obtained. Your brain relies on omega-3 fatty acids for proper health, and function.
